Velvet Revolution: Raw Footage of Soviet Troops Leaving Czechoslovakia (1990)

On 26 February 1990, Czechoslovakian President and face of the Velvet Revolution, Václav Havel met with Mikhail Gorbachev in Moscow to sign a pact on the total withdrawal of Soviet troops from Czechoslovakia. The same day, ITN crews in Czechoslovakia filmed Red Army troops as the first contingents left the country, bringing to an end the military occupation called a "temporary deployment" by Soviet leaders that began with the USSR's violent suppression of the Prague Spring in 1968. This historic footage of Soviet withdrawal is presented alongside footage filmed two days before, on 24 February, of a predemocracy rally led by Havel in Prague.
